Landscape grading and resloping include improving the surface to enhance drainage, prevent erosion, and create aesthetically appealing outdoor spaces. Appropriate grading directs water away from structures, minimizes pooling, and supports healthy plant growth. The process starts with assessing the existing topography, soil type, and preferred water circulation. Heavy machinery or hand grading might be utilized to change slopes, level locations for lawns, and develop functional areas such as balconies or walkways. Resloping likewise supports long-term landscape health by preventing soil disintegration, decreasing stress on plants, and maintaining appropriate drain. Well-executed grading guarantees structural stability, boosts visual appeal, and protects the residential or commercial property from water-related damage
